As for YouTube, it should work by creating triggers with the "YouTube"-Source selected, then the dropdown should show you which events you can select. Sadly currently there is an issue with the YouTube connection, where I have to resolve it with google, which likely will take a while for now :/ (Google usually takes very long to take care of matters of small developers like me)

A workaround is just having Streamlabs or Streamelements connected, since those should forward YouTube events aswell, without needing YouTube connected directly!
